In a thrilling opening day of the Sports Premiership, Coleraine FC secured a 3-1 victory over Dungannon Swifts. The Bannsiders demonstrated their intent from the start with goals from Jay Henderson, Ben Doherty, and Matthew Shevlin. Manager Ruaidhri Higgins spoke to Coleraine TV after the match, expressing his satisfaction with the team's performance.

‘It was a fantastic win for us,’ said Higgins. ‘We knew we were up against a very strong Dungannon Swifts side, so it’s great to come out on top.’ The manager highlighted how his players managed to score at crucial moments in the game, which ultimately ensured they left Stangmore Park with three valuable points.

‘The goals came at important times,’ Higgins continued. ‘We needed those scores to maintain our momentum and keep Dungannon Swifts under pressure. It’s always tough starting a new season, but this win gives us a great boost of confidence.’

Despite the victory, Coleraine FC faced some setbacks as Cameron Stewart and Rowan McDonald were withdrawn from the match due to knocks. Higgins admitted he is closely monitoring their fitness status ahead of future games.

‘We’re just hoping that both players will be back on their feet soon,’ said Higgins. ‘Their absence was a blow, but we’ll do our best to support them in their recovery.’

The win over Dungannon Swifts sets Coleraine FC up for a strong start to the season and positions them well as they aim to compete at the top of the league table.
